Online & Distance Learning at Millersville University of Pennsylvania
Online coursework is an option at Millersville University of Pennsylvania. Of 6,975 students, 1,229 (18%) studied exclusively online and 1,878 (27%) took at least some classes online.

Earnings for History Graduates from Millersville University of Pennsylvania
Graduates of Millersville University of Pennsylvania’s History program earn at the following median levels (per the U.S. Department of Education’s College Scorecard):
| Years After Graduation | Median Earnings |
|---|---|
| 1 year | $38,218 |
| 2 years | $27,048 |
| 3 years | $32,842 |
| 4 years | $41,577 |
| 5 years | $50,876 |
How does this compare to the school overall? Four years after graduating, History graduates from Millersville University of Pennsylvania earn a median of $41,577, compared with $51,978 for all Millersville University of Pennsylvania graduates — about 20% lower than the school-wide median.
Median Debt at Graduation
Median student loan debt for History graduates from Millersville University of Pennsylvania is $26,000.
